The Fine Print Nobody Reads (But You Should)

I am going to sound like a boring parent here. But the terms and conditions of these “10 free no deposit casino UK 2026 claim today” deals are brutal. I read every single one during my testing. Here are the worst offenders:

  • Max bet limit: Most casinos cap your bet size when using bonus funds. Usually £5 per spin. If you bet more, they void the bonus.
  • Game restrictions: Some slots contribute 100% to wagering. Others contribute only 10% or 0%. Table games like blackjack often contribute 0%.
  • Max cashout: I saw a casino (I will not name them) that gave a £10 free bonus but capped winnings at £20. So even if you win £100, you only get £20. Check this before you play.
  • Payment method restrictions: If you deposit using Skrill or Neteller, some casinos exclude you from the no deposit bonus. Use a debit card or PayPal.

I hate this fine print. But ignoring it will cost you money. Always read the T&Cs. Always.

FAQ: Quick Answers for the 10 Free No Deposit Offer

Can I withdraw the £10 immediately?

No. The £10 is bonus credit. You must wager it (usually 30x to 40x) before you can withdraw any winnings. You cannot withdraw the bonus itself.

Do I need to deposit to claim the 10 free no deposit?

No. That is the whole point. No deposit required. You just register and claim the bonus. However, some casinos ask you to add a payment method for verification, but you do not need to fund it.

Is this available for existing players?

Almost never. These “10 free no deposit” offers are exclusively for new UK players. Existing players get reload bonuses or free spins on deposits.

What happens if I win the jackpot with the free bonus?

This is rare, but it happens. If you hit a progressive jackpot like Mega Moolah using a no deposit bonus, the casino will usually cap your winnings. Read the T&Cs. Most cap jackpot wins at £10,000 or even less.
